About Traffic Officers
Introduction to Traffic Officers as a profession
Traffic officers are professionals who are responsible for maintaining traffic flow and ensuring the safety of drivers and pedestrians on the road. They work in the public sector and are an essential part of society, ensuring that traffic moves smoothly and that accidents are prevented.Role of Traffic Officers in maintaining traffic flow and safety
Traffic officers play a critical role in maintaining traffic flow and safety. They regulate traffic at intersections and other critical points, ensuring that drivers follow the rules of the road. They also monitor traffic for potential hazards, such as construction zones or accidents, and take appropriate action to keep traffic moving and prevent accidents.Different types of Traffic Officers and their responsibilities
There are different types of traffic officers, each with its own set of responsibilities. Some officers are responsible for enforcing traffic laws and issuing citations to drivers who break them. Others are responsible for directing traffic at intersections and other critical points. Additionally, some officers are responsible for investigating accidents and helping to develop new traffic safety initiatives.Training and qualifications required to become a Traffic Officer
To become a traffic officer in the public sector, candidates must have a high school diploma or equivalent. They must then complete a training program, which typically lasts between six and twelve months. During this time, they learn about traffic laws, regulations, and procedures, as well as the skills necessary to manage traffic flow and prevent accidents.Recruitment process for Traffic Officers in the Public Sector
Recruitment for traffic officers in the public sector typically involves a competitive and rigorous process. Candidates must submit an application, undergo a background check, and pass a series of exams and tests. Those who are successful then move on to a training program, where they learn the skills and knowledge necessary to become a traffic officer.Salary and benefits of Traffic Officers in the Public Sector
Traffic officers in the public sector typically earn competitive salaries and benefits. They may receive health insurance, retirement benefits, and other perks, depending on their specific employer. Salaries for traffic officers vary, depending on factors such as experience, qualifications, and job location.Challenges faced by Traffic Officers in their day-to-day work
Traffic officers face a variety of challenges in their day-to-day work, including dealing with angry or aggressive drivers, managing traffic during adverse weather conditions, and dealing with the stress of the job. They must also be able to remain alert and focused for extended periods of time, which can be challenging in a job that requires so much attention to detail.Importance of Traffic Officers in maintaining order and safety in society
Traffic officers are an essential part of maintaining order and safety in society. Without traffic officers, traffic would not flow smoothly, and accidents would be much more prevalent. By enforcing traffic laws and ensuring that drivers follow the rules of the road, traffic officers help to keep our roads safe and prevent accidents.Future outlook for the Traffic Officer profession
The future outlook for the traffic officer profession is positive, with continued demand for skilled professionals who can help to maintain traffic flow and safety. With new technologies and innovations being developed all the time, there are many opportunities for traffic officers to learn new skills and take on new challenges in the coming years.Ways in which the Public can support Traffic Officers in their work
The public can support traffic officers in their work by following the rules of the road, being patient and courteous when interacting with traffic officers, and reporting any unsafe or dangerous situations they observe on the road. By working together, we can help to keep our roads safe and ensure that traffic officers can continue to do their essential work.
